Car leaves scene of crash leaving scooter rider seriously injured in Leeds

A scooter driver has been left with serious injuries following a collision with a car that didn't stop early this morning.

West Yorkshire Police say it happened at 03.50am on Dewsbury Road at the junction with Trentham Street when the bike and a dark-coloured Volkswagen were in collision.

The bike, a Pulse 125 Lightspeed, was being ridden along Dewsbury Road in the direction of Leeds and the other vehicle was travelling in the opposite direction when the collision occurred.

A spokesperson said that the Volkswagen did not stop at the scene and as a result of the incident the scooter rider was left with serious injuries.

Any witnesses to the incident or who saw the vehicles immediately before the incident are asked to contact police on 101 quoting log 155.
